Sr. Microsoft Dynamics 365 Developer
Sr. Microsoft Dynamics 365 Developer

Sr. Microsoft Dynamics 365 Developer

Wakefield Full-Time 104000 - 116000 Β£ / year (est.) Home office (partial)
Go Premium
I

At a Glance

  • Tasks: Lead the design and optimisation of Dynamics 365 CRM and web applications.
  • Company: Insight Global connects talent with opportunities in tech and engineering.
  • Benefits: Enjoy medical, dental, vision insurance, 401k matching, and paid time off.
  • Why this job: Great autonomy, mentoring opportunities, and a chance to shape tech solutions.
  • Qualifications: 5+ years in Dynamics 365, Azure, and Agile environments; SQL proficiency required.
  • Other info: Remote work options available; competitive salary range of $130,000 - $140,000.

The predicted salary is between 104000 - 116000 Β£ per year.

Get AI-powered advice on this job and more exclusive features.

This range is provided by Insight Global. Your actual pay will be based on your skills and experience β€” talk with your recruiter to learn more.

Base pay range

$130,000.00/yr – $140,000.00/yr

  • 5+ years developing and customizing Microsoft Dynamics 365 CRM solutions.
  • 5+ years working with Azure Cloud technologies and Microsoft Power Platform.
  • 5+ years building websites, web APIs, and working in Agile/Scrum environments.
  • Proficiency with relational (SQL Server) and NoSQL databases, including query optimization.
  • Advanced knowledge of Git and DevOps tools (e.g., Docker, Jenkins).

Nice to have:

  • Microsoft Dynamics 365 certification (e.g., MB-200, MB-400)
  • Microsoft PowerApps Platform certifications
  • Azure experience or Azure Certification (Solutions Architect or Developer)

Description:

Insight Global is assisting a client in identifying a Sr. Microsoft Dynamics 365 Developer to lead the design, development, and optimization of our CRM and web applications. This role offers significant autonomy and decision-making authority, ideal for someone with deep technical expertise and a passion for mentoring others.

Key Responsibilities

  • Customize and optimize Dynamics 365 CRM to meet business needs.
  • Integrate client APIs using Azure services and Microsoft Power Platform (Power Apps, Power Automate).
  • Design and implement plugins, workflows, and custom entities to extend CRM functionality.
  • Write efficient SQL queries for reporting and data management (SQL Server).
  • Mentor junior developers and promote best practices in software design and development.
  • Conduct code reviews and contribute to the evolution of development standards.
  • Provide coaching and support to enhance team performance and technical skills.
  • Collaborate with the CIO and technical teams on architecture planning and process improvements.
  • Ensure availability, security, and scalability of cloud-hosted applications.
  • Troubleshoot infrastructure issues and optimize for performance and cost-efficiency.
  • Develop RESTful APIs and manage data exports between Dynamics 365 and third-party platforms.
  • Collaborate with cross-functional teams to integrate CRM with external systems and interactive products.

Annual Compensation:

$130,000 – $140,000

Exact compensation may vary based on several factors, including skills, experience, and education.

Benefit packages for this role will start on the 31st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.

Seniority level

  • Seniority level

    Mid-Senior level

Employment type

  • Employment type

    Full-time

Job function

  • Job function

    Engineering and Information Technology

  • Industries

    Insurance

Referrals increase your chances of interviewing at Insight Global by 2x

Inferred from the description for this job

401(k)

Medical insurance

Vision insurance

Paid maternity leave

Paid paternity leave

Get notified about new Dynamics Developer jobs in Wakefield, MA .

Boston, MA $160,000.00-$160,000.00 4 days ago

Boston, MA $130,000.00-$180,000.00 6 months ago

Boston, MA $90,000.00-$185,000.00 5 days ago

Reading, MA $80,000.00-$100,000.00 2 weeks ago

Boston, MA $80,000.00-$90,000.00 2 weeks ago

Boston, MA $150,000.00-$175,000.00 3 months ago

Boston, MA $125,000.00-$178,000.00 1 month ago

Boston, MA $125,000.00-$178,000.00 4 months ago

Boston, MA $100,000.00-$110,000.00 3 weeks ago

Boston, MA $108,760.00-$173,800.00 4 days ago

Graduate Software Engineer – Up to $110k + Bonus

Ipswich, MA $95,295.00-$136,135.00 2 days ago

Software Engineer: Full-Stack Web Developer

Software Engineer I (Intern) United States

Boston, MA $44,000.00-$130,000.00 1 day ago

Frontend Software Developer- React/Redux

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r

Sr. Microsoft Dynamics 365 Developer employer: Insight Global

At Insight Global, we pride ourselves on fostering a dynamic work culture that encourages innovation and collaboration. As a Sr. Microsoft Dynamics 365 Developer, you will enjoy competitive compensation, comprehensive benefits starting from day 31, and ample opportunities for professional growth through mentorship and leadership roles. Our commitment to employee well-being and development makes us an exceptional employer in the vibrant tech landscape of Wakefield, MA.
I

Contact Detail:

Insight Global Recruiting Team

StudySmarter Expert Advice 🀫

We think this is how you could land Sr. Microsoft Dynamics 365 Developer

✨Tip Number 1

Network with professionals in the Microsoft Dynamics community. Attend meetups, webinars, or conferences to connect with others who work in this space. This can lead to valuable referrals and insights about job openings.

✨Tip Number 2

Showcase your technical skills through personal projects or contributions to open-source initiatives. Having a portfolio that demonstrates your expertise in Dynamics 365, Azure, and related technologies can set you apart from other candidates.

✨Tip Number 3

Engage with online forums and communities focused on Microsoft Dynamics and Azure. Participating in discussions can help you stay updated on industry trends and may even catch the attention of recruiters looking for talent.

✨Tip Number 4

Consider obtaining relevant certifications if you haven't already. Certifications like MB-200 or MB-400 can enhance your credibility and demonstrate your commitment to professional development in the Dynamics 365 ecosystem.

We think you need these skills to ace Sr. Microsoft Dynamics 365 Developer

Microsoft Dynamics 365 Customisation
Azure Cloud Technologies
Microsoft Power Platform
Web API Development
Agile/Scrum Methodologies
SQL Server Proficiency
NoSQL Database Management
Query Optimisation
Git Version Control
DevOps Tools (Docker, Jenkins)
RESTful API Development
Code Review and Best Practices
Mentoring and Coaching
Cross-Functional Collaboration
Troubleshooting Infrastructure Issues
Performance Optimisation

Some tips for your application 🫑

Tailor Your CV: Make sure your CV highlights your experience with Microsoft Dynamics 365, Azure Cloud technologies, and the Power Platform. Use specific examples of projects you've worked on that demonstrate your skills in these areas.

Craft a Strong Cover Letter: In your cover letter, express your passion for mentoring and leading development teams. Mention any relevant certifications you hold, such as Microsoft Dynamics 365 or Azure certifications, and how they relate to the role.

Showcase Technical Skills: Clearly outline your proficiency with SQL Server, NoSQL databases, Git, and DevOps tools in your application. Provide examples of how you've used these technologies to solve problems or improve processes in previous roles.

Highlight Agile Experience: Since the role involves working in Agile/Scrum environments, be sure to mention your experience with Agile methodologies. Discuss any specific contributions you've made to Agile teams, such as conducting code reviews or mentoring junior developers.

How to prepare for a job interview at Insight Global

✨Showcase Your Technical Expertise

Be prepared to discuss your experience with Microsoft Dynamics 365, Azure Cloud technologies, and the Power Platform. Highlight specific projects where you've customised CRM solutions or integrated APIs, as this will demonstrate your hands-on skills.

✨Demonstrate Problem-Solving Skills

Expect to face scenario-based questions that assess your ability to troubleshoot and optimise applications. Prepare examples of how you've resolved infrastructure issues or improved performance in past roles, showcasing your analytical thinking.

✨Emphasise Mentorship Experience

Since the role involves mentoring junior developers, be ready to share your experiences in coaching others. Discuss how you've promoted best practices in software design and contributed to team development, which will highlight your leadership qualities.

✨Prepare for Code Reviews

As code reviews are part of the responsibilities, brush up on your knowledge of coding standards and best practices. Be ready to explain your approach to reviewing code and how you ensure quality and maintainability in software development.

Sr. Microsoft Dynamics 365 Developer
Insight Global
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

I
  • Sr. Microsoft Dynamics 365 Developer

    Wakefield
    Full-Time
    104000 - 116000 Β£ / year (est.)

    Application deadline: 2027-09-02

  • I

    Insight Global

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>